Construction Simulator: Evolution will now launch in Early Access for PC via Steam before its full release across PlayStation 5, Xbox Series, and PC, developer astragon Entertainment announced. An Early Access release date was not announced.
astragon Entertainment said the new release model will allow the development team to incorporate the community’s feedback in the game’s ongoing development. A roadmap of planned updates will introduce content over time.
Demolition was also revealed as a new gameplay feature in Construction Simulator: Evolution. Here are the latest details:
Players will be able to use officially licensed machines and suitable attachments from both new and returning licensing partners. These include the SENNEBOGEN 670 E equipped with a wrecking ball, the hydraulic Combi Cutter CC 1600 U with universal jaws from Epiroc, and a handheld demolition hammer from Wacker Neuson. Choosing the right machine and attachment will depend on the material that needs to be demolished.
Construction Simulator: Evolution‘s demolition feature will be playable at Gamescom 2026, which will run from August 26 to 30 at Koelnmesse in Cologne, Germany.
